Cancún is blessed with over 240 days of sunshine per year. Its glorious white beaches are picture-perfect. Isla Mujeres, a tiny offshore island like others found in the Caribbean, shares the same enviable climate, but offers a totally different vacation experience, with little of the hustle and bustle of Cancún. This guidebook gives you the low-down on where to go and what to do, no matter what your budget or lifestyle. Maps, photos, index.
